Amplitude x SegmentStream
Amplitude is one of the leading product analytics platforms for startups and enterprises alike, used by over 4,900 companies and 26% of the Fortune 100. Teams on Amplitude already track the behavioural events behind adoption, retention, cohorts, and the rest of the product picture.
Marketing measurement is a different scope. Which channels bring the users who adopt and retain, and what each one truly adds: behavioural events alone cannot answer that. It takes ad cost, CRM outcomes, an identity graph, and models that turn all of it into a budget decision.
That is what SegmentStream does: advanced marketing measurement on top of the raw events Amplitude already exports to your warehouse. It adds cost from 30+ ad platforms and outcomes from your CRM, then turns all three into cross-channel attribution, incrementality and marginal ROAS, and budget recommendations you can push straight to the platforms.
Product analytics stays in Amplitude. Marketing measurement and optimization run in SegmentStream: where the next dollar should go, and how to prove it worked.
New data source: OpenAI Ads
Campaign spend from OpenAI Ads now flows into SegmentStream automatically, alongside Google, Meta, TikTok and every other channel you run.
Ads on ChatGPT surfaces are a new line item in a lot of budgets, and most teams read that performance in isolation, inside OpenAI's Ads Manager, against OpenAI's own numbers. That says nothing about how the channel behaves next to the rest of the mix.
What you can do:
- See OpenAI Ads spend and delivery next to every other channel in one report
- Run attribution across the full mix with OpenAI Ads included, not estimated
- Let portfolio optimization move budget on real numbers
Generate an API key in Ads Manager → Settings, add the data source in SegmentStream, paste the token, pick your ad account. Data lands within an hour.
New data source: StackAdapt
You can now load your StackAdapt campaign spend and delivery metrics into SegmentStream for attribution reporting and marketing mix portfolio optimization.
To start, generate a read-only API token in StackAdapt. In SegmentStream, add a new StackAdapt data source, paste the token, select the advertiser you want to sync, and click Save.
UTM parameters are parsed from each ad's click URL, so spend joins to your session data on utm_source, utm_medium and utm_campaign. No landing page template changes needed.
